第7章MCS-51单片机系统扩展ppt课件.ppt

第7章MCS-51单片机系统扩展ppt课件.ppt

ID:59016657

大小:1.00 MB

页数:30页

时间:2020-09-26

第7章MCS-51单片机系统扩展ppt课件.ppt_第1页
第7章MCS-51单片机系统扩展ppt课件.ppt_第2页
第7章MCS-51单片机系统扩展ppt课件.ppt_第3页
第7章MCS-51单片机系统扩展ppt课件.ppt_第4页
第7章MCS-51单片机系统扩展ppt课件.ppt_第5页
资源描述:

《第7章MCS-51单片机系统扩展ppt课件.ppt》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、第七章 MCS-51单片机系统扩展程序存储器扩展数据储存器扩展并行I/O口扩展片内ROM形式无ROMEPROM子系列51系列80318051875180C3180C5152系列8032805280C3280C52片内ROM容量87C51875287C524KB4KB8KB8KB片内RAM容量128B128B256B256B寻址范围2×64KB2×64KB2×64KB2×64KBI/O特性计数器并行口串行口2×164×81个2×164×83×164×83×164×81个1个1个中断源5个5个6个6个问题的提出6.1程序存储器ROM的扩展片内资源:8051有片内ROM的容量:4K片外可

2、扩展64KROM有关的引脚有:EA*可用来扩展的存储器芯片:EPROM:2716(2K×8)、2732、2764、27256等EEPROM:2816、2864、28128等还要用到锁存器芯片:例74LS373EPROM扩展实例——在8031单片机上扩展4KB的EPROM2732A11..A8A7...A0O7..O0OEGNDCE12根地址线8根数据线8031P0.7...P0.0P2.3P2.2P2.1P2.0ALEPSENEA373GQ7Q0D7D0…控制线读外部程序存储器时序ALEPSEN1个机器周期送地址取出指令注意:上述时序是在取指令的过程中自动产生的!地址范围的确定取决

3、于CE*(片选)和地址线的接法。本例中CE*接地。请确定地址范围。试根据电路图确定EPROM的地址范围。注意:实训电路中CE*的连接,当同时扩展多片ROM时,可采用译码法或线选法来分别选中芯片,每个芯片分配的地址范围不同。P2.3P2.2P2.1P2.0P0.7P0.6P0.5P0.4P0.3P0.2P0.1P0.0A11A10A9A8A7A6A5A4A3A2A1A000000000000000000000010.0.0.0.0.0.0.0.0.0.1.111111111111000.000000000000000011010000共212个单元,即容量=212=4096=4KB2

4、732地址范围:0000H~0FFFH2764A12...A8A7...A0O7..O0OEVppVGMCE8031P0.7...P0.0P2.4P2.3P2.2P2.1P2.0ALEPSENEA373GQ7Q0D7D0…P2.7P2.6P2.574LS138+5VY0提问:CE*接地时2764的地址范围是多少?0000H~1FFFHY1地址范围是多少?8000H~9FFFH74LS138Y1P2.7P2.6P2.574LS138Y12864A12...A8A7...A0I/O7..I/O0OEVccWE8031P0.7...P0.0P2.4P2.3P2.2P2.1P2.0ALE3

5、73GQ7Q0D7D0…RDWR+5VCEGNDOE6264A12...A8A7...A0I/O7..I/O0OECE2WE8051P0.7...P0.0P2.4P2.3P2.2P2.1P2.0ALE373GQ7Q0D7D0…RDWR+5VCE1OEP2.7P2.6P2.574LS138Y1EA3-8地址译码器:74LS1386.2举一反三——RAM的扩展6264RAM的地址范围可与2764ROM的相同。因为不同的指令访问将产生不同的控制信号。ROM:MOVC指令及取指令操作——PSEN*有效。RAM:MOVX指令——PSEN*无效,WR*/RD*有效。MOVXA,@DPTR;读操

6、作,产生RD*低电平信号MOVX@DPTR,A;写操作,产生WR*低电平信号试确定图中的EEPROM芯片2864是程序存储器还是数据存储器使用?——看控制线。读/写外部数据存储器时序ALEPSEN1个机器周期RD*/WR*送地址访问ROM取出MOVX指令1个机器周期注意!上述粉色线时序是在执行MOVX指令情况下的!线选法P2.7P2.6P2.5P2.4P2.3P2.2P2.1P2.0A7A6A5A4A3A2A1A0Ⅱ:1010000000000000=A000H~1011111111111111~BFFFHP2.7P2.6P2.5P2.4P2.3P2.2P2.1P2.0A7A6A5

7、A4A3A2A1A0Ⅲ:0110000000000000=6000H~0111111111111111~7FFFHP2.7P2.6P2.5P2.4P2.3P2.2P2.1P2.0A7A6A5A4A3A2A1A0Ⅰ:1100000000000000=C000H~1101111111111111~DFFFH74LS138译码片选法ABCY0*Y1*Y2*各片存储器芯片分配地址:Ⅰ:0000H~1FFFHⅡ:2000H~3FFFHⅢ:4000H~5FFFH6.3并行I/O口

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。